Country Fire Authority volunteer fireman Harry Carlin stands in the blackened remains of The Black Range State Forest near Buxton, a month after a fireball swept through the area. The Black Saturday bushfires, which began on 7th February 2009, were the deadliest in Australia's history. The fires killed 173 people, displacing 7,500 and destroying 2,000 homes over an area of 450,000 hectares. 34 people died in this area.........
